She is an inventor to a patent on a novel
Brugia malayi recombinant gene and antigen which has been filed in three
countries and subsequently invented Brugia Rapid kit which is a rapid
dipstick test for detection of brugian filariasis. This test has been
commercialized and is the world-first serological assay for this infection.
